County Offices Closed For Holiday

POSTED: 7:49 am PDT July 4, 2008
UPDATED: 7:50 am PDT July 4, 2008

Courts and all San Diego city and county government offices will be closed Friday in observance of Independence Day.

Refuse and recyclables will be collected one day later than usual in the city of San Diego. Garbage collection scheduled for Friday will instead be picked up Saturday.

Tickets won't be issued for expired city parking meters or in areas scheduled for street sweeping.

City and county libraries will be closed, as will community and recreation centers. All city pools will be open.

County and city parks will be open. The Balboa Park, Mission Bay and Torrey Pines municipal golf courses will also be open.

There will be no mail delivery.

Metropolitan Transit System trolleys and buses will operate on a holiday schedule, as will North County Transit service. The Coaster train from Oceanside to downtown San Diego will not operate.

The courts and San Diego city and county government offices will resume normal schedules on Monday.
